Transaction 7422b384923767e32f5cf171dc16acf1da5645e18d4a426bec017f28c5f5675a
1 Input
1 Output
-
7422b384923767e32f5cf171dc16acf1da5645e18d4a426bec017f28c5f5675a:0
- value
- 98950000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 051b1f8e67deca8da90771e7e4a49e74e4f60604 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1TzsWyP7VAJ1vVjfmoxApBvbXEw6oSVBC